Ethereum Gains Momentum as Institutional Investors Return

After facing a period characterized by extreme fear, capital outflows, and general uncertainty, Ethereum is demonstrating renewed strength. The world’s second-largest cryptocurrency has reclaimed the psychologically significant $2,900 level, signaling a potential shift in market sentiment. This resurgence appears to be driven not merely by speculative trading but by substantial purchases from established institutions and corporations. The critical question for investors is whether this marks the beginning of a sustained recovery or merely a temporary rally.

Macroeconomic Winds and Ecosystem Developments Provide Support

Beyond direct capital inflows, broader economic factors are contributing to Ethereum’s improved outlook. Market expectations for a Federal Reserve interest rate cut in December have surged dramatically, climbing from 40% to 82% within a single week. This shift creates a favorable environment for risk-on assets like cryptocurrencies. Simultaneously, a major advancement within the Ethereum ecosystem was unveiled: MegaETH announced a substantial $250 million bridge initiative. This project aims to tackle the issue of fragmented liquidity in the decentralized finance (DeFi) sector. With an estimated 95 percent of DeFi liquidity currently underutilized, this new infrastructure seeks to enhance capital efficiency significantly. Such foundational improvements are vital for restoring long-term confidence and solidifying Ethereum’s position as a leading smart-contract platform.

Significant Institutional Capital Flows Back In

Following two weeks of stagnation, U.S. spot Ethereum ETFs are reporting notable inflows, totaling approximately $96.67 million. A single fund, BlackRock’s Ethereum ETF, accounted for the vast majority of this sum, attracting $92.61 million. This activity signals that institutional players are using recent price corrections as an entry point. The conviction extends beyond traditional finance; on-chain data reveals compelling activity. BitMine Immersion Technologies has substantially increased its Ethereum holdings, acquiring an additional 21,000 ETH worth roughly $59 million. This wallet, funded via FalconX, is identified as a long-term holder. Large-scale acquisitions of this nature during a period of market unease send a powerful message: informed participants maintain strong belief in the network’s future.

Technical Analysis Points to Potential Breakout

From a technical perspective, Ethereum has made a critical move. Having successfully defended its key support level at $2,800, the asset is now trading between $2,900 and $2,942, marking a 24-hour gain of up to 2.7 percent. Chart analysts note that Ethereum is attempting to break out of a downward channel that has been in place since September. A bullish divergence observed in the RSI indicator suggests that selling pressure is waning. The immediate and decisive resistance level to watch is $3,000. A clean breakout above this threshold could pave the way for a test of the 200-day moving average, located around $3,150. However, analysts advise caution, noting that only a sustained daily close above $2,900 would confirm a genuine near-term trend reversal.
